Guest guest Posted December 31, 1998 Report Share Posted December 31, 1998 Dear sanjay Our pooja has three steps. Sthula(gross), Sukshma(subtle) and para(transcedent). The Sthula pooja cansists of the navavarana pooja with the patra stahpanam naivedyam etc. The Antaryaga bef,. the avahana is the sukshma(subtle) and constant rememberance and accepting the world as her manifeatation is the para. at one point of the upasana one will resort to mental rather than the physical pooja.
